#55f96f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#55f96f is composed of 33.3% red, 97.6%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.4%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 129.5 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 65.5%. #55f96f color hex could be obtained by blending #aaffde with #00f300.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#55f96f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#edfeef is the lightest one.

Tones of #55f96f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a6a8a6 is the less saturated color, while #55f96f is the most saturated one.
